#53a6d0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53a6d0 is composed of 32.5% red, 65.1%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.1% cyan, 20.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 200.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 57.1%. #53a6d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#004da1.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#53a6d0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#53a6d0 has RGB values of R:83, G:166,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5482192.

Shades and Tints of #53a6d0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0d is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#53a6d0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9395 is the less saturated color, while #29b4fa is the most saturated one.
